- [ ] Step 7: Archive cold storage buckets (Glacierline tier). Confirm both ceremony witnesses are present, verify bucket manifests match the Oxbow ledger, then seal the archive key shares. Plugin authors may observe but not handle shares. Once sealed, the archive index itself is encrypted and can only be reopened with the passphrase below.

vault phrase of badup-hahig = tamael-aldael-kelmir-istael-fenok-istwyn-tamius-jorath-oliion

Visitors to the Kestrel prototype workshop at Dunmore Works must be pre-registered and accompanied at all times. Reception should issue a red lanyard, confirm photo ID, and log entry and exit times. Photography is not permitted inside the workshop. If the escorting engineer is delayed, visitors wait in the atrium. The workshop door code for escorts is below.

staff pass of kahop-kadup = bdg-NCCCQ-99141

## Changelog — Crumbline order-cutoff defaults

The bakery order-cutoff rule in Crumbline changed. Same-day orders now close at 10:00 local store time instead of noon, and weekend cutoffs are handled per store rather than globally. The override flag store managers used previously is deprecated and ignored. If alerts fire about rejected late orders after deploy, that's expected for the first day. The service now runs with these configuration values.

settings of tagef-bawif:
DRUIX_HOST=druix.zemvarlabs.internal
DRUIX_PORT=8000

To: Dispatch Desk
Subject: Raffle drums — Friday delivery

Receiving site: two raffle drums from Pennygold Events arrive Friday before noon via Sparrowhatch Couriers. Brass fittings scratch easily — blanket wrap stays on until they're inside the hall. Sign the consignment slip, note any dents, and hold both in the storeroom, not the lobby. At hand-over, give the driver the instruction that follows below.

courier memo of yawep-yafog: the pramir ulaix courier leaves the ulavan aldix frair zorok oliiel joreth rusdor fenvan ledger at gate 1305 under passcode 514738